The Lucky Coq premises on Windsor's Chapel Street for sale

The Windsor home of late night venue The Lucky Coq on the busy Chapel Street has been listed for sale for the first time in nearly five decades. 

The 355 sqm site with double street frontage at 179 Chapel Street  is currently leased to multi-venue hospitality operators Colonial Leisure Group.

Subject to a 12 year lease, the prime property has a 3am 'general' liquor licence in place.

CBRE Hotels agents Scott Callow and Will Connolly have expressions of interests until September 12.
